Apologies if this is obvious and already in progress, but the issue with 
Windows and this change appears to be that the "utf-8.file" file is being 
treated as text rather than binary.

So the line ending is expanding to CRLF.  The working copy of utf-8.file on my 
Windows workers is actually 21 bytes, not 20.
